Feels Like A Storm: Lisa Speaks To Tiffany Ahead Of The Release Of Her New Album ‘Pieces Of Me’

September 19, 2018

Lisa battled technology and Storm Ali to speak to Tiffany ahead of the release of the singer’s new album and her UK tour.
